Finished garment - Early Tudor lady's gown as featured on the front cover of The Queen's Servants historic_knitting The range of colours isFinished garment Tudor Tailor exclusive Early Tudor lady's gown with W neckline, matching partlet and velvet bonnet made for The Queens Servants book and featured on the front cover! Worn only for a photoshoot and two special events. Made in black silk camlet (a fine grosgrain) edged with dark crimson velvet. Narrow sleeves fasten at the wrist with handmade silk laces finished with handmade brass aiglets threaded through seven pairs of hand worked
